What attractions can I visit near Es Baluard Museum in Palma?

Nestled in Palma’s historic old town, Es Baluard Museum of Modern and Contemporary Art has plenty of fascinating sights nearby. Just a few steps away lies the ancient city walls and Es Baluard fortress, offering visitors sweeping views over the bay and a perfect spot to watch the sunset. Wandering through the narrow streets, you’ll discover Palma Cathedral, a stunning Gothic masterpiece that dominates the skyline with its soaring spires and intricate stained glass.

The bustling Plaça Major is also close, a lively square lined with cafés and markets where you can soak up the island’s vibrant atmosphere. For a culinary detour, try traditional mallorcan dishes like pa amb oli and sobrassada at local tavernas scattered throughout the area. If you fancy a scenic escape, the tree-lined Paseo Marítimo waterfront promenade invites a leisurely walk or bike ride along the Mediterranean. From Palma’s cultural highlights to charming eateries and seaside views, the surroundings of Es Baluard provide a delightful introduction to the city’s rich blend of history, art, and everyday life.
